1
1
mirror of https://github.com/Rundll86/Dog-Lynx-And-HCN.git synced 2026-05-28 06:51:54 +08:00

15 Commits

Author SHA1 Message Date
fallingshrimp 4302055086 refactor(武器卡片): 重构武器卡片节点结构,将名称节点移至displays容器
统一将武器卡片的名称节点从container/info移动到container/info/displays容器中,提高代码组织性
同时清理了部分调试属性和冗余代码,更新了部分武器的来源信息
2026-04-04 09:03:58 +08:00
fallingshrimp 747b057b22 refactor(武器系统): 重构VectorStar武器和子弹逻辑
调整VectorStar子弹的移动逻辑,移除forwarded变量并优化速度计算
修改VectorStar武器的属性计算公式,调整基础值和成长系数
更新VectorStar场景配置,调整攻击力、冷却时间等参数
将Rooster角色的默认武器替换为VectorStar
2025-12-22 15:37:24 +08:00
fallingshrimp d0e3564933 feat(武器系统): 重构武器信息显示逻辑并添加新功能
重构武器卡片的信息显示逻辑,使用ItemShow组件替代原有Label显示
添加武器升级和镶嵌前的预览功能
为武器描述添加升级前后数值对比显示
新增FREQUENCY数据类型支持
统一子弹生命周期参数为lifeTime
2025-10-01 07:58:09 +08:00
fallingshrimp bc3368f25f feat(武器): 调整多个武器的能量消耗和属性数值
- 降低LGBT武器的能量需求从50到25,并添加沙滩球信息
- 为Meowmere武器添加1.0能量需求并调整伤害数值
- 降低VectorStar武器的能量需求从10到5并移除调试标记
- 调整ChainGun武器的攻击力和分裂间隔,能量需求从1改为2
2025-09-30 17:53:29 +08:00
fallingshrimp b6662e6ffa fix(武器): 调整武器数值和配置
- 将多个武器的升级时间系数从0.05降低到0.02
- 为VectorStar、MushroomPickaxe和PurpleCrystal添加或调整costBeachball值
- 修改MushroomPickaxe的needEnergy从1.0增加到2.0
- 更新紫水晶簇的伤害显示和价格
2025-09-20 17:37:39 +08:00
fallingshrimp 007f323482 refactor(武器系统): 重构武器能量消耗机制
移除全局武器升级能量消耗倍数,改为各武器独立设置升级能量消耗
调整矢量核心武器的属性计算和初始能量值
为所有武器类型添加升级时的能量消耗增量
2025-09-20 17:30:05 +08:00
fallingshrimp 90f7f28649 feat(武器): 调整武器属性和描述
修改武器升级消耗参数,更新LGBT和VectorStar武器的显示名称和描述文本,优化物品掉落数量计算逻辑
2025-09-10 22:31:47 +08:00
fallingshrimp 1f8e0a3e5a fix(Weapons): 调整武器升级消耗和能量需求
修改武器升级后的棒球消耗和能量需求计算方式,使用GameRule中的全局变量控制倍数
移除VectorStar的debugRebuild标志并调整其能量需求
2025-09-09 22:32:07 +08:00
fallingshrimp 6a4f5e8baf feat: 更新FullscreenPanelBase和VectorStar组件,优化UI布局和武器属性 2025-09-06 21:12:11 +08:00
fallingshrimp 1340df0d08 fix: 调整VectorStar武器的最大和最小发射数量,更新描述文本 2025-09-06 18:55:34 +08:00
fallingshrimp 78e2cfbc03 fix(Weapons): 调整武器冷却时间配置
将LGBT武器的冷却时间从500ms增加到1000ms以平衡游戏性
为VectorStar武器添加500ms的冷却时间配置
2025-09-06 17:00:42 +08:00
fallingshrimp 63a4022031 fix(Weapons): 修正武器能量消耗和描述文本
更新VectorStar和LGBT武器的能量消耗值以匹配实际配置
重构LGBT武器的描述文本使其更清晰准确
为LGBT武器添加debugRebuild标志用于调试
2025-09-06 16:59:42 +08:00
fallingshrimp e4684678bc fix(武器): 调整武器能量消耗和属性参数
- 将VectorStar的能量消耗从20调整为25
- 将LGBT的能量消耗从50降低到30,同时提高power属性从0.15到0.2
- 移除两个武器的debugRebuild调试标记
2025-09-06 16:55:56 +08:00
fallingshrimp 19e7d7691d refactor(武器系统): 调整武器数值显示格式和数据结构
统一武器数值显示格式,将浮点数显示为整数或保留两位小数。修改storeType从数组改为字典结构以提高可读性。调整部分武器参数平衡性,包括BigLaser的时间系数和LGBTWeapon的power增量。移除VectorStarWeapon的mincount升级逻辑。为所有武器组件添加debugRebuild标志和默认500点costBeachball值。在FieldShow.gd中新增INTEGER数据类型处理。更新武器描述模板中的数值格式化逻辑。
2025-09-06 16:11:59 +08:00
fallingshrimp 95db9deb3c feat: 添加矢量星武器和子弹功能
实现新的矢量星武器系统,包括武器卡片、子弹行为和粒子效果。主要功能包括:
- 添加VectorStarWeapon.gd武器脚本,支持多子弹发射和追踪目标
- 实现VectorStar.gd子弹脚本,包含初始冲刺和后续追踪逻辑
- 添加相关场景资源和配置
- 将新武器添加到公鸡角色的武器库中
2025-09-06 13:27:00 +08:00